The National Certificate for Designated Premises Supervisors is designed to provide Designated Premises Supervisors (DPS) responsible for day to day running of any premises licensed to sell alcohol, with the skills and knowledge to carry out their responsibilities in a professional manner and uphold the objectives outlined in the Licensing Act 2003. The course examines the day to day issues involved in running a successful and compliant licensed premises. Under current legislation the Designated Premises Supervisor is identified as the 'single point of accountability' for a premises licensed to sell alcohol; they therefore carry additional responsibility for all the activity undertaken on the premises. Who should attend this course? The course is designed for candidates who are already acting as Designated Premises Supervisor at their premises or those who are expecting to take on this responsibility in the future. Candidates should have completed the National Certificate for Personal Licence Holders (NCPLH), hold a personal licence or have suitable levels of experience before registering for the NCDPS course. Please note; A DPS is required to hold a personal licence. The course is suitable for supervisory staff working in both the on-trade (Pubs, bars, nightclubs. Hotels, restaurants etc.) and in the off-trade (off-licenses, supermarkets, licensed retail outlets etc.) What does the course cover? How is the course assessed? The course is assessed via a short 30 minute, 30 question multiple-choice examination; candidates must attend all sessions of the training and achieve 24/30 in their examination in order to pass and to be awarded their certificate. Who accredits the course? The course is accredited by the BIIAB. Beyond The Blue are approved to administer training and examinations by the BIIAB. The BIIAB Level 2 National Certificate for Designated Premises Supervisors is endorsed by the police and is accredited by the Qualifications and Curriculum Authority (QCA) as a level 2 qualification. Level 2 means it is a qualification which supports employment progression. The qualification counts towards other BIIAB qualification schemes. Why choose Beyond The Blue as your training provider?
